1) if he mentions name of family members police will file case of abetment to suicide . against them

2) it will carry out investigations . merely filing claim of maintenance does not amount to abetment to suicide

1. File DV case and pray for maintenance and ad interim maintenance,

2. Audio Record all his demands and threats of committing suicide,

3. Lodge a police complaint before hand alleging that he is blackmailing your sister for committing suicide if his demand is not fulfilled,

4. this police complaint will vaccinate you against any charge of abating his committing suicide at a later date.
